Control (HMI@Web – Connection to PC and LAN/WAN)
3rd Step Setting the Web@HMI for Connection
The Web@HMI controller can be configured from the
web interface (the same one which serves for normal
operation of the system). Enter the following IP ad-
dress http://192.168.1.199 in the address field in the
web browser and confirm with the "Enter" button.
Note: The Web@HMI configuration for the con -
nection itself is not dependent on the browser used.
Enter log-in data in the fields of the Web Server dialog box
– see the figure:
User name:
WEB (or ADMIN)*
Password:
SBTAdmin!
* ADMIN only if the WEB log-in is non-functional
(for older systems)
Figure 33 – Web Server dialog box
There is an account for one user on the HMI@Web Web
Server. The Web Server user log-in name and password can
be changed in the menu: Connection >> LAN Connection.
Upon successful log-in to the HMI@Web Web Server, the
Start screen is displayed.
Figure 34 – Start screen
To access the Main Menu, it is necessary to log in at the cor-
responding access level. Upon selecting the link on the first
line the log-in dialog box to enter the password is displayed.
The input field for entering the password is at the bottom of
the browser. Enter log–in data to the fields of the dialog box
– see the figure above; enter password – 4444.
(factory pre-set access password to the HMI@Web – for the
first start-up.

Attention – it is only valid until changed.
These log-in data correspond to the highest level user authori-
sation (role: service) – they should only be reserved for the
supplier performing the installation or the service provider.
It is advisable to change the log-in data as soon as upon
first log-in (Passwords >> Password change – actual or
lower access level password change is offered). The dialog
box to enter a new password is displayed at the bottom of
the browser. Press the Save button to confirm and save the
changes to the settings.
Warning
Once the changes have been made, it will no longer be possible
to use the original data to log in. Keep your log-in data safely
stored (keep them confidential). If you lose them, contact the
manufacturer or authorized service representative.
Apart from the service log-in data, it is also necessary to
modify other user pre-set log-in data to enable access to the
HMI@Web for the operating staff – rename them according
to the actual authorised users and change the correspond-
ing passwords:
Role
Pwd
SERVICE
4444
ADMINISTRATOR
3333
USER
2222
GUEST
0000
Note: If the user settings are not performed within this phase
of commissioning, it is necessary to perform them at the lat-
est during training of the operating staff or device handover
to the end user.
